About

London Pride is one of the largest Pride celebrations in Europe — a day-long parade and festival celebrating the LGBTQ+ community that fills central London with colour, music, joy, and solidarity. The parade typically runs from Hyde Park Corner along Piccadilly to Trafalgar Square, with floats, marching groups, dancers, and tens of thousands of participants representing organisations, charities, and community groups. The atmosphere is extraordinary — hundreds of thousands of people line the route, and the energy is joyful and inclusive. Trafalgar Square hosts a main stage with live music and speeches. Soho becomes one enormous street party. Events and parties continue across the city well into the night. It's simultaneously a political statement, a community celebration, and one of the best days out in London. The parade is free to watch. Various ticketed events happen alongside the main parade. Soho and Vauxhall host the most concentrated nightlife celebrations. The event typically takes place on the last Saturday of June or first Saturday of July. Arrive early for a good viewing spot along the parade route — Piccadilly and Regent Street are the most popular areas.
